6
कोई भी gtk.Widget (उदाहरण के लिए एक प्रगति पट्टी) gtk.Menu में मेनू आइटमों में से एक के रूप में कैसे रखा जा सकता है?gtk.Menu में मनमाने ढंग से विजेट कैसे डालें?
कोई भी gtk.Widget (उदाहरण के लिए एक प्रगति पट्टी) gtk.Menu में मेनू आइटमों में से एक के रूप में कैसे रखा जा सकता है?gtk.Menu में मनमाने ढंग से विजेट कैसे डालें?
PyGTK documentation से हवाला देते हुए:
gtk.MenuItem और उसके व्युत्पन्न विजेट उपवर्गों ही मान्य मेनू के बच्चे हैं।
तो जवाब है: आप नहीं कर सकते। लेकिन:
gtk.MenuItem gtk.bin के उप-वर्ग है, यह किसी भी वैध बाल विजेट को पकड़ सकता है।
आप एक लेबल के बिना एक MenuItem बनाते हैं:
item = gtk.MenuItem()
आप सबसे gtk.Widget
उपवर्गों एक बच्चे के रूप item
को जोड़ सकते हैं।